Creating an Avatar: Representing Yourself Online

Today, we are talking about avatars, and how you can create a representation of yourself for an online environment. Your task is to create an avatar, and then upload it into your Glogster account. There are a few ways you can do this. You can:

Go into Bitstrips and use your avatar from there (or, create a new one)

Use one of these avatar sites to make your own.

When you are ready to save your avatar to the laptop, and then move it up into Glogster, here is what you do:

  • If the site has a download image link, use that to download your avatar.
  • If not, then use the screenshot capture option on the Mac.
    •  click press Command-Shift-4.
      • A cross-hair cursor will appear.
      • Click and drag to select the area you wish to capture.
      • When you release the mouse button, the screen shot will be automatically saved as a PNG file on your desktop.

Go to Glogster.edu, and sign in.

  • Go to your Dashboard
  • Click on “Edit my Profile”
  • Use the “Change Photo” link
  • Upload your avatar
